Nestled in the prestigious Bath Road area, this beautifully presented one-bedroom garden flat offers a perfect blend of period charm and contemporary living. Boasting a newly fitted kitchen, a private garden, and a prime location close to Cheltenham town centre, this exceptional property is ready to be called home.

Accessed via its own private entrance, the flat immediately impresses with high-quality flooring and a thoughtful layout. The spacious living room is bathed in natural light and features bespoke fitted shelving, creating an inviting and stylish space ideal for relaxation and entertaining.

The contemporary kitchen, newly fitted in 2025, is a highlight of the home. It offers sleek units, integrated appliances, and ample workspace, alongside a convenient breakfast bar area. From the kitchen, direct access leads out to the private garden, seamlessly connecting indoor and outdoor living.

The generous double bedroom provides a tranquil retreat with practical fitted storage, ensuring a clutter-free environment. Completing the interior is a modern shower room, exquisitely finished with luxury tiling and high-quality fittings.

One of this property's most appealing features is its private garden, a rare find in such a central location, offering a peaceful outdoor space for enjoyment. Additionally, a useful external outbuilding provides valuable storage.

Situated on the sought-after Bath Road, the flat benefits from excellent access to local shops, cafes, and amenities, all within easy walking distance. Cheltenham town centre is also just a short stroll away, providing a wealth of shopping, dining, and cultural opportunities.

This Grade II listed property perfectly combines historical character with modern comfort, making it an ideal choice for those seeking a convenient and stylish lifestyle in Cheltenham.
